Test Engineer
DUTIESSupport Agile development QA requirementsReview and analyze system specificationsDevelop effective strategies and test plansSoftware DevelopmentExecute test cases (manual or automated) and analyze resultsEvaluate product code according to specificationsCreate logs to document testing phases and defectsReport bugs and errors to development teamsHelp troubleshoot issuesConduct post-release/ post-implementation testingWork with cross-functional teams to ensure quality throughout the software development LifecycleEnsure compliance with all federal accessibility standards and guidelinesIdentify and manage project risksProvide documentation in the form of Test Management Plans, Test Cases and Test Reports throughout the complete software development lifecyclePerform other duties as assigned by supervisor or managerTECHNICAL KNOWLEDGETypes of testing:FunctionalRegressionIntegrationAutomatedPerformance508 ComplianceMobile/Multiplatform Testing (BrowserStack)API (REST, SOAP, WSDL) TestingSecurity/Penetration Testing (SonarQube, Burp Suite)Stress/Load (LoadView, etc.)Environment / Methodology: Agile: Kanban, ScrumLanguages: SQL / Java / JavaScript/ Bash / PythonMINIMUM QUALIFICATIONSBachelor's Degree in Computer Science, Engineering, related IT field or equivalent experience5-7 years of experience in software quality assurance and testing Qualified applicants will have experience using non-manual testing tools, e.g., Selenium, Cypress, Apache JMeter, which includes development of automated scripts and automated test execution. Must have a good understanding of common web application security vulnerabilitiesStrong verbal and written communication skills for discussions with development teamPREFERRED QUALIFICATIONSExperience with Capability Maturity Model Integration (CMMI)Demonstrated experience in creating and executing test scripts, and communicating results to managementGood overall IT technical skillsBasic understanding of programming languages (for automated script creation/updates), especially JavaScriptHighly organized and detail orientedFlexible, versatile, and works well under pressureStrong sense of urgency and ability to prioritizeHendall Inc., is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.